Legal Maneuvering
One of the most controversial aspects of Robyn and Kody's marriage was Kody's decision to divorce his first wife, Meri, in order to legally marry Robyn. This wasn't just a formality. By legally marrying Robyn, Kody could adopt her children, ensuring their place in the Brown family with all the legal protections and benefits that come with it. This move was presented as being primarily for the sake of Robyn’s children, but it stirred up a lot of emotions and questions within the family. Meri, in particular, faced a tough time dealing with this decision, as she had been the original matriarch of the family. This legal restructuring underscored the evolving nature of the Brown family dynamic, highlighting the sacrifices and compromises that come with their lifestyle.
